Carmine Giovinazzo was born on August 24, 1973 in Richmond [now Staten Island], New York City, New York, USA as Carmine Dominick Giovinazzo. He is an actor and writer, known for CSI: NY (2004), Black Hawk Down (2001) and For Love of the Game (1999). He was previously married to Vanessa Marcil.

His first major acting job was in the Buffy the Vampire Slayer (1997) pilot, "Welcome to the Hellmouth." Credited only as "Boy," he was the first character to die.
Is of Italian, Norwegian, English and Native American descent.

Was a guest star on the original CSI: in 2002, on "Revenge is Best Served Cold", and starred as Danny in CSI Miami episode "MIA/NYC Nonstop", and has therefore has appeared in all three CSI-series. He is one of very few actors to do so.

In his spare time, Carmine enjoys painting, poetry and playing the guitar. He also likes to play roller hockey, basketball and baseball.

wanted to become a professional baseball player, but due to a back injury he had to give up baseball and started his acting career
